Understanding Silk Quality
Not all silk ties are created equal. The weight, weave, and finish of the fabric all play a role in how a tie drapes, knots, and holds its shape throughout the day. A high-quality silk tie should feel smooth yet substantial — never flimsy or stiff.

Getting the Knot Right
The tie you choose should also suit the knot you prefer. Heavier silk jacquard ties work best with a Four-in-Hand or Half Windsor knot, which keeps the knot proportionate and elegant. Avoid over-tightening — silk is a natural fiber that responds best to gentle handling.
Width & Length: The Fit Details
A standard tie width of 7–8 cm is the most versatile and timeless choice. It works with most lapel widths and suit cuts. The tip of your tie should always reach your belt buckle — no shorter, no longer.
